SNAP Benefits Stolen Through Electronic Theft Are Now Eligible for Replacement

September 1, 2023

SNAP households impacted by EBT card skimming and phishing scams can now file a claim to replace stolen benefits. For benefits stolen between Oct. 1, 2022 – Aug. 21, 2023, the deadline to apply is Oct. 31, 2023.

Community Eligibility Provision State Subsidy Expansion

June 9, 2023

The enacted FY2024 State Budget included an additional $134.6M to expand access to free school meals through the new Community Eligibility Provision (CEP) State Subsidy.
